BelleHarvest adds Milt Fuehrer as CEO

BelleHarvest has hired Milt Fuehrer as the company’s chief executive officer. Fuehrer takes over leadership of the sales and packing operations headquartered in Belding, Michigan.

He joins the BelleHarvest team from Palermo’s pizza in Milwaukee, Wisconsin where he served as president. “This is an exciting move for me, as I join a great company that is working hard to provide healthy, accessible food to families everywhere,” Fuehrer said

“We are very excited to welcome Milt to our team,” said Cliff Foster, chairman of the BelleHarvest board of directors. “Not only will he bring a fresh perspective, he will share his extensive experience in the food industry and assist with our growing customer portfolio.”

BelleHarvest is a company committed to delivering high-flavor varieties such as Smitten, which allow BelleHarvest to compete with chips and candy as it works to, “Take Back the Snack.”
